Notice is hereby given that the kstessora have
now placed in the Tre urer , s ogles the Dupll-f
cites of City. Poor, City 814111e51, SChOOI,SChOOI I
Building and Atlitic Park Taxes, and of Water
Bents for the year 1869, and that said taxes will
now be received In pursuance of the Acts of As
sembly of Peorary Stith, 1860, and of April
14th, 1863, subject to the following regulations
and allowances: • •
rive per cent. if petit on or before the trot day
of July. Your per cent. if paid on or before tb
trot day of Anted. Two per cent. if paid on o
before the trot day of September. If paid aft
the first day of September. and on of before the
trot day of October, no deduction will be made.
•lf paid after the first day of October, and on o
befbre the first day of November, an addition o
fiviper cent. shall be added to and payable o•
the same.
After the first of 'November warrants will ln
issued to enforce thf. collection of all texts re
maiming unpaid, together with the percentage
accrued thereon, and the costs. -
D. XACTERSON
City Treasurer.

Proposals for Two steamers for . Re
moving Obstructions.
REALED PROPOSALS utll be received at the
office of the 'Jolted States Engineer's in the Cs-
Wm House Building; Pittsburgh, Pa.. until u 6
ole'ock P. 31. of WEDNP SDA.Y. JUNE 16th,
1569. for Grnishingfrwo Light Draught Bt,c am.
era, Crane Boats and Plats, to employed by
contract by day's work,ln removing
Obstructions fiom thei Ohio River,
Consisting of snagsl trees, the
logs, boats,
barges. wrecks. &c. Bidden' ) must -specify the
price per day for each day's ay rk, for which they
arta agree to furnish everath ng necessary. and
do the work ander the supele-driace of a Per
priceo be appointed bv the s d Engineer. Said
to cover the furnishing f a light draught
.reamer. one crane 1 boat. two st'ongly decked
flats. and the necessary screws, chains ropy s,
levers. saws, axes.; fixtures, Ste., suitable Ibr
such work, and including the pay sad expenses
of tfaatain, Pilot. Engineer and drew, besides
one maoager or working boss in addition and one
gang ot sight men each for doing the work, and
having suitable accommodations for the Govern
ment inspector.
All expenses to bevaid, and all risks Nome by
the party proposing; it being understood that the
'government Wall not be responsible for the pay
ment of anything more than the sum per day
teat may be agreed nponsu the contract.
The right is t eberved to reject any or all bids if
It shall be deemed for the Interest of the Govern
ment so to do. i •
specifications and a blank form of proposals
will be furnished onlapplication, from this office,
ctc er In person or by writing. •
The proposals must be accompanied by the
smarantyof two responsible sureties, signed on
the printed form.
By order of
• Brig-General A. A, lIITIAPHRETS,
Chief of Engineers of the Army of the 11-84.-
W. bilL2toll ROBERTS, U.S. (Aril Engineer.
ittohargd Ohio River Improvement.
PITTSBURGH, PA,, June 7. 1869. ielifitai
